            Re: Anybody use Prgressive's Snapshot?

            Originally posted by Neatong6er View Post
            I have heard that there have been some problems that can cause permenant damage to your car. Wouldn't recommend it.
            How? It only records the data. The reports of damage from the device have no basis and are purely circumstantial, such as saying "I put the Snapshot in and then 3 days later my HVAC blower stopped working. It must be this dang thing." The only negative that Progressive states is that it slowly drains the battery so it recommended to turn your car on once a month to let the alternator charge the battery.

                            Re: Anybody use Prgressive's Snapshot?

                            Originally posted by Ringo64 View Post
                            This thing bothers me. Does it take averages on your driving cause what happens if I have to do a move that looks "un-safe" to the giro and GPS but it saves my life? Does my insurance go up for staying alive?

                            Next thing is you have to trust Progressive to know each and every car's ECM and other avenues to get info and electricity which obviously coming from some statements, I wouldn't.

                            Just something about this coming from the insurance company just screams no to me.
                            The program cannot raise your rates or current premium. It is a potential discount. It accesses the information from the OBD-II protocol which is universal across all models since 1996. Why do you think a single OBD-II scanner can read from any post-1995 car?
